ENA is an indigenous organisation, which was established by Non-governmental Organisations (NGOs) workers from Kenya as a facility to meet the information requirements of NGOs in East Africa, in order to enhance their involvement in particular in international decision-making processes that impinge on sustainable development in East Africa. The purpose of the Organisation is to enhance the role of East Africa's NGOs and community-based organisations (CBOs) to influence policy-making on issues of sustainable development, in particular on environment, trade and information. In this regard, EcoNews Africa supports the policy implementation and experience sharing among NGOs and CBOs in order to influence policy formulation and review. EcoNews Africa activities are undertaken in collaboration with established service-delivery and advocacy NGOs and CBOs. All of the activities are financed through grants and/or gifts provided by various donor agencies. EcoNews Africa is governed by a ten-member Board of Directors, drawn from individuals with expertise on the voluntary sector and/or areas of operation of the organisation. The Secretariat implements the decisions of the Board of Directors. The projects of the Organisation are implemented through four broad programme areas namely, Core (administration), Multilateral Development Initiatives, Community Media Programme and the Environment programme.
